However, we always caution people about trusting any reviews they see about pet crematoriums. There are two reasons for this.
Firstly, they could well be fake. There is a big industry geared towards writing fake reviews. We will never take part in this.
Secondly, it is very difficult for people to be able to judge a pet crematorium. Most reviews you read will be focused on how nice the people were or how beautifully the ashes were presented. Whilst these are important points it does not mean the cremation was carried out properly or honestly.
